The Ningbo Meidong Container Terminal, also called Meishan Terminal, has suspended all inbound and outbound services after an employee received a positive COVID-19 test on Tuesday, August 10th. The terminal is one of five in the port of Ningbo.

The closure restricts shippers from picking up empty equipment or gating-in containers. While some industry leaders indicate that there is opportunity to redirect the flow of cargo, they also warn of potential delays and congestion, citing the Yantian port partial shutdown from late May.

Some carriers have reported that their warehouses in the port’s free trade zone have been forced to close as well.

This terminal primarily serves the China-Europe trades, China-Middle East trades and the “OCEAN” Alliance services; Hapag-Lloyd, Cosco Shipping, OOCL, and Evergreen call at the Meidong terminal.
